What is recorded here

In pasture, located at the base of a N-facing slope, on top of which a rath (MA103-032----) is located. An expanse of lowlying boggy pasture stretches to N. Low, flat-topped, roughly oval or oblong mound (10m N–S; c. 6.5m E–W; H 0.2m), which appears to be composed of shattered stone fragments in a black, charcoal-rich soil. There is a shallow slightly sunken indentation (2m E−W; 1.8m N−S) towards the N end of the E side, but it is not clear if this represents a trough hollow. The W edge of the mound is indistinct, and the S side is bordered by a partly silted up, vegetation-clogged field drain. Compiled by: Jane O’Shaughnessy Date of upload: 23 November 2022
